Manchester United striker Romelu Lukaku has rediscovered his finishing touch brilliantly, scoring a superb goal in each half to help them win a 3-1 Premier League win at Crystal Palace on Wednesday.

The victory allowed Ole Gunnar Solskjaer to win 11 games without defeat and to strengthen the Norwegians' hopes of securing the post on a permanent basis after their replacement of Jose Mourinho in December.

He left United in fifth place with 55 points in 28 games, one behind Arsenal (fourth) and two ahead of Chelsea (sixth), who has one game less, while the three-way race for a Champions League spot is a good one. ; intensifies.

Lukaku gave United the advantage in the 33rd minute thanks to a skilful finish from the edge of the penalty area after a superb solo run through the left-back. Luke Shaw, who defeated three defenders of the palace.

The Belgian striker qualified 2-0 in 52nd place thanks to a tight volley after Chris Smalling and Victor Lindelof tipped their heads in a corner. Ashley Young.

Right-back Joel Ward scored a goal for Palace in the middle of the second half with a diving header before Young landed an unstoppable low shot in the final stages to seal United's victory.
